Understanding Arithmetic Progression (AP)
Arithmetic progression is a sequence of numbers in which each term after the first is obtained by adding a fixed constant to the previous term. For example, 2, 4, 6, 8, 10 is an AP with a common difference of 2. AP is used in various fields such as mathematics, finance, and economics to model real-world situations.The Formula of Sum in AP
The formula of sum in AP is given by: Sn = n/2 (2a + (n-1)d) Where: Sn = Sum of n terms n = Number of terms a = First term d = Common difference This formula can be derived by adding the terms of the AP and using the formula for the sum of an arithmetic series.Step-by-Step Guide to Using the Formula of Sum in AP
To use the formula of sum in AP, follow these steps:- Identify the first term (a) and the common difference (d) of the AP.
- Determine the number of terms (n) you want to find the sum for.
- Plug the values of a, d, and n into the formula Sn = n/2 (2a + (n-1)d)
- Simplify the expression to find the sum (Sn)
For example, let's say we have an AP with a first term of 5, a common difference of 3, and we want to find the sum of the first 6 terms.
Example Problem
Using the formula of sum in AP, we get: Sn = 6/2 (2(5) + (6-1)3) Sn = 3 (10 + 15) Sn = 3 (25) Sn = 75 Therefore, the sum of the first 6 terms of the AP is 75.Real-World Applications of the Formula of Sum in AP

What is an Arithmetic Progression (AP)?
An arithmetic progression is a sequence of numbers in which each term after the first is obtained by adding a fixed constant to the previous term. This fixed constant is called the common difference (d). The general form of an arithmetic progression is given by: a, a + d, a + 2d, a + 3d, ..., a + (n - 1)d, where 'a' is the first term and 'n' represents the number of terms in the sequence.Derivation of the Formula for Sum of AP
